preen - Dictionary definition and meaning for preen

PREEN

listen
  • (verb) dress or groom with elaborate care

    "She likes to dress when going to the opera"

    synonyms : dress , plume , primp

  • (verb) pride or congratulate (oneself) for an achievement

    synonyms : congratulate

    He stepped on the stage to collect his prize, preening himself like a superstar! -added by naila_inlas

  • (verb) clean with one's bill

    "The birds preened"

    synonyms : plume

    The pigeons sat by the water trough and preened themselves till their feathers were smooth. -added by naila_inlas
